Publications

Selected publications by Xinglang Zhang.

Semiotic Logical Hexagon Theory for LLM Logical Reasoning arXiv 2026

Yunyao Zhang*, Xinglang Zhang*, Zeliang Chen, Junqing Yu, Zikai Song (* Equal contribution)

arXiv preprint, 2026. Extended from our ACL 2026 Oral paper.

Introduces HexLogicAgent and a formal logical hexagon theory that organizes complete semantic opposition before deduction, improving the reliability of LLM logical reasoning across multiple models and benchmarks.

Logical Phase Transitions: Understanding Collapse in LLM Logical Reasoning Accepted to ACL 2026

Xinglang Zhang*, Yunyao Zhang*, et al. (Corresponding author: Zikai Song)

ACL 2026 Main Conference, 2026. Also on arXiv:2601.02902

Identifies critical logical complexity thresholds in LLMs and proposes a model-agnostic Logical Complexity Metric (LoCM) alongside a neuro-symbolic curriculum tuning framework.

Too Good to Be Real: AI Synthetic Preference Misreads What Real Humans Reward Under Review

Xinglang Zhang, Yuanmeng Xiang, et al. (Corresponding author: Zikai Song)

Under review, 2026.

Proposed an ontology-based preference decomposition framework and uncovered a synthetic-real preference gap: LLMs overvalue explicit reasoning, while real platform users reward affective and expressive salience.

IntervenSim: Intervention-Aware Social Network Simulation for Opinion Dynamics

Yunyao Zhang, Zuocheng Ying, Xinglang Zhang, et al. (Corresponding author: Zikai Song)

arXiv preprint, 2026. Also on arXiv:2604.06600

Introduces an intervention-aware closed-loop simulation framework that jointly models source-side interventions and crowd feedback to better capture evolving opinion dynamics in online social networks.
